WHO ARE WE
S-RM is a global intelligence and cyber security consultancy. Since 2005, we’ve helped companies, governments and private individuals solve some of their most complex challenges.
Our Corporate Intelligence division uses the latest research and intelligence-gathering techniques to investigate how companies and individuals really do business in today’s world. We work with some of the most prominent and sophisticated organisations to help them understand partners, customers, assets and territories across the globe - the healthcare company a private equity firm wants to invest in; the prospective client a bank wants to onboard; the market a multinational wants to enter. We also provide specialised investigative support to law firms, businesses and individuals in contentious situations such as litigation, commercial disputes and internal investigations.
From our offices in London, Manchester, New York, Washington DC, Hong Kong, Kuala Lumpur, Singapore and Cape Town, we deliver critical insights from every country across the world. Further information about each of our five Corporate Intelligence practice areas can be found on our website: Compliance Due Diligence, Deal Advisory, Disputes & Investigations, and Strategic Intelligence.

S-RM is a global intelligence and cyber security consultancy. Founded in 2005, we have 400+ practitioners spanning nine international offices, serving clients across all regions and major sectors.
We support our clients by providing intelligence that informs critical decision-making and strategies, from investments and partnerships through to disputes; by helping organisations build resilience to cyber security threats; and by responding to cyber-attacks and organisational crises.
Client focus is at the heart of what we do. Our advice is direct, honest and objective. We deliver actionable results for our clients by bringing together the best talent and creating teams designed to address unique problems and complex challenges.
